Fire Alarm Systems: Early Detection and Swift Response

A well-designed fire alarm system serves as a vigilant guardian, instantly detecting signs of fire and triggering timely alerts. These systems consist of various components such as smoke detectors, heat sensors, alarms, and control panels. Modern fire alarms are equipped with intelligent technology, capable of sensing even the faintest hint of smoke or a rise in temperature. This ensures swift evacuation and containment of potential fire incidents.

Installing Fire Alarm Systems: Step-by-Step Guide

The process of installing a fire alarm system involves several crucial steps:

Assessment and Planning: The supplier assesses your building's layout and potential fire risks. Based on this analysis, they create a customized plan for optimal sensor and alarm placement.

Wiring and Connectivity: The installation team meticulously installs the necessary wiring and establishes connections between sensors, alarms, and the control panel. Precision is key to ensuring efficient communication between components.

Testing and Calibration: Once installed, the system undergoes rigorous testing and calibration. This ensures that each component functions flawlessly and responds accurately to potential threats.

Training: A reputable fire alarm supplier offers training to building occupants, educating them about alarm signals and evacuation procedures. This step maximizes the effectiveness of the system during real emergencies.

Frequently Asked Questions about Fire Alarm Suppliers in Kenilworth

How do I choose the right fire alarm supplier?

Choose a supplier with a solid reputation, positive customer feedback, and relevant certifications. Look for one that tailors solutions to your building's unique needs.

Can I install a fire alarm system myself?

It's highly recommended to entrust fire alarm installation to professionals. DIY installation could result in improper setup, compromising the system's effectiveness.

How often should I test my fire alarm system?

Regular testing should occur at least once a month. Professional maintenance and testing should also take place annually to ensure optimal functionality.

Are wireless fire alarm systems available?

Yes, wireless fire alarm systems are available and offer flexibility in installation. However, their suitability depends on factors like building size and layout.

What certifications should a fire alarm supplier have?

Look for suppliers with certifications from recognized bodies such as the National Institute for Certification in Engineering Technologies (NICET) or the Electronic Security Association (ESA).

How can I verify if my fire alarm system complies with regulations?

A reputable supplier will ensure that your system aligns with local fire safety regulations. They should provide documentation to confirm compliance.
